kecerdasan buatan

31
KECERDASAN BUATAN

Upload: beto-go

Post on 12-Dec-2015

68 views

Category:

Documents


6 download

DESCRIPTION

KECERDASAN BUATAN

TRANSCRIPT

Page 1: KECERDASAN BUATAN

KECERDASAN BUATAN

Page 2: KECERDASAN BUATAN

Definisi Kecedasan Buatan Merupakan kawasan penelitian, aplikasi dan

instruksi yang terkait dengan pemrograman komputer untuk melakukan sesuatu hal - yang dalam pandangan manusia adalah – cerdas (H. A. Simon [1987])

Sebuah studi tentang bagaimana membuat komputer melakukan hal-hal yang pada saat ini dapat dilakukan lebih baik oleh manusia (Rich and Kinight [1991])

Page 3: KECERDASAN BUATAN

• Mengetahui dan memodelkan proses –proses berpikir manusia dan mendesain mesin agar dapat menirukan perilaku manusia (John McCarthy [1956] ).

Kecerdasan Buatan (AI) merupakan cabang dari ilmu komputer yang dalam merepresentasi pengetahuan lebih banyak menggunakan bentuk simbol-simbol daripada bilangan, dan memproses informasi berdasarkan metode heuristic atau dengan berdasarkan sejumlah aturan (Encyclopedia Britannica)

Page 4: KECERDASAN BUATAN

Bagian Utama yg Dibutuhkan untuk Aplikasi Kecerdasan Buatan (AI): Bebasis Pengetahuan (Knoledge Base)

Berisi fakta-fakta, teori, pemikiran, dan hubungan antara satu dengan lainnya.

Motor Inferensi (Inference Engine)Kemampuan menarik kesimpulan berdasarkan pengetahuan.

Page 5: KECERDASAN BUATAN

Pengertian Kecerdasan Buatan

Page 6: KECERDASAN BUATAN

Berfikir Seperti Manusia Diperlukan suatu cara untuk

mengetahui bagaimana manusia berfikir Diperlukan pemahaman tentang

bagaimana pikiran manusia bekerjaBagaimana Caranya ? Melalui introspeksi atau mawasdiri,

mencoba menangkap bagaimana pikiran kita berjalan

Melalui percobaan psikologis.

Page 7: KECERDASAN BUATAN

Berfikir Rasional Cara berfikirnya memenuhi aturan logika yang

dibangun oleh Aristotles Pola struktur argumentasi yang selalu memberi

konklusi yang benar bila premis benar Menjadi dasar bidang logika

Tradisi logistik dalam AI adalah membangun program yang menghasilkan solusi berdasarkan logika

Problem Pengetahuan informal sukar diuraikan dan

dinyatakan Dalam bentuk notasi logika formal Penyelesaian secara prinsip vs praktis

Page 8: KECERDASAN BUATAN

Bertindak Rasional

Bertindak secara rasional artinya bertindak di dalam upaya mencapai tujuan (goal)

Di dalam lingkungan yang rumit tidaklah mungkin mendapatkan rasionalitas sempurna yang selalu melakukan sesuatu dengan benar

Page 9: KECERDASAN BUATAN

Sejarah Kecerdasan Buatan Istilah kecerdasan buatan pertama kali

dikemukakan pada tahun 1956 di konferensi Darthmouth.

Tahapan sejarah perkembangan kecerdasan buatan :

o Era komputer elektronik (1941) Telah di temukan alat sebagai komputer

elektronik yang dikembangkan di USA dan Jerman.

Komputer tersebut memerlukan ruangan yang luas dan ruang AC yang terpisah.

Melibatkan konfigurasi ribuan kabel. Penemuan ini menjadi dasar pengembangan

program yang mengarah ke kecerdasan buatan.

Page 10: KECERDASAN BUATAN

Tahapan sejarah perkembangan kecerdasan buatan :

o Masa Persiapan AI (1943-1956) Warren McCulloch & Walter Pitts berhasil membuat

suatu model sel syaraf tiruan (1943). Norbert Wiener membuat penelitian mengenai prinsip

teori feedback (1950). John McCarthy (bapak kecerdasan buatan) melakukan

penelitian bidang Automata, JST dan pembelajaran intelijensia dengan membuat program yang mampu berfikir.

Page 11: KECERDASAN BUATAN

Tahapan sejarah perkembangan AI :o Awal Perkembangan AI (1952-1969)

Kesuksesan Newell dan Simon dengan program “General Problem Solver”. Program ini digunakan menyelesaikan masalah secara manusiawi.

McCarthy mendemokan bahasa pemrograman tingkat tinggi yaitu LISP di MIT AI Lab.

Nathaniel Rochester dari IBM dan mahasiswa-mahasiswanya mengeluarkan program AI yaitu “Geometry Theorm Prover” yang mampu membuktikan suatu teorema (1959).

Page 12: KECERDASAN BUATAN

Tahapan sejarah perkembangan AI :o Perkembangan AI melambat (1966-1974)

Program AI yang bermunculan hanya mengandung sedikit atau bahkan tidak mengandung sama sekali pengetahuan pada subjeknya.

Banyaknya permasalahan yang harus diselesaikan oleh AI, karena terlalu banyaknya masalah yang berkaitan, maka tidak jarang terjadi kegagalan ketika membuat program AI.

Ada beberapa batasan pada struktur dasar yang digunakan untuk menghasilkan perilaku intelijensia, contohnya dua masukan data yang berbeda tidak dapat dilatih untuk mengenali kedua masukan yang berbeda.

Page 13: KECERDASAN BUATAN

Tahapan sejarah perkembangan AI :o Sistem berbasis pengetahuan (1969-1979)

Ed Feigenbaum, dkk. Membuat program untuk memecahkan masalah struktur molekul (Dendral Programs) yang berfokus pada segi pengetahuan kimia.

Saul Amarel dalam proyek “Computer in Biomedicine” membuat program dari segi pengetahuan diagnosa medis.

Page 14: KECERDASAN BUATAN

Tahapan sejarah perkembangan AI :o AI menjadi sebuah industri (1980-1988)

Ditemukannya expert system (R1) yang mampu mengkonfigurasi sistem-sistem komputer.

Booming industri AI juga melibatkan banyak perusahaan besar yang menawarkan software tools untuk membangun sistem pakar.

Page 15: KECERDASAN BUATAN

Tahapan sejarah perkembangan AI :o Kembalinya Jaringan Syaraf Tiruan (1986-sekarang)

Hopfield mengembangkan teknik mekanika statistik untuk mengoptimasi jaringan syaraf tiruan (1982).

David Rumelhart & Geoff Hinton menemukan algoritma back-propagation. Algoritma ini berhasil diimplementasikan pada bidang ilmu komputer dan psikologi (1985).

Page 16: KECERDASAN BUATAN

Detail Kecerdasan Buatan Sudut Pandang Kecerdasan

Kecerdasan buatan mampu membuat mesin menjadi cerdas (berbuat seperti yang dilakukan manusia)

Sudut Pandang Penelitian

Kecerdasan buatan adalah studi bagaimana membuat komputer dapat melakukan sesuatu sebaik yang dilakukan manusia

Page 17: KECERDASAN BUATAN

Sudut Pandang Bisnis

Kecerdasan buatan adalah kumpulan peralatan yang sangat powerful dan metodologis dalam menyelesaikan masalah bisnis

Sudut Pandang Pemrogram

Kecerdasan buatan meliputi studi tentang pemrograman simbolik, problem solving, dan pencarian (searching)

Page 18: KECERDASAN BUATAN

Dua bagian Utama Kecerdasan Buatan

Basis Pengetahuan (knowledge base)

berisi fakta-fakta, teori, pemikiran dan hubungan komponen satu dengan yang lainnya

Motor Inferensi (inference engine)

Kemampuan menarik kesimpulan berdasar pengalaman. Berkaitan dengan representasi dan duplikasi proses tersebut melalui mesin (misalnya, komputer dan robot).

Page 19: KECERDASAN BUATAN

Konsep Kecerdasan Buatan

Turing Test

Metode Pengujian Kecerdasan (Alan Turing).

Proses uji ini melibatkan seorang penanya (manusia) dan dua obyek yang ditanyai.

Pemrosesan Simbolik

Sifat penting dari AI adalah bahwa AI merupakan bagian dari ilmu komputer yang melakukan proses secara simbolik dan non-algoritmik dalam penyelesain masalah.

Page 20: KECERDASAN BUATAN

Heuristic

Suatu strategi untuk melakukan proses pencarian (search) ruang problem secara efektif, yang memandu proses pencarian yang kita lakukan di sepanjang jalur yang memiliki kemungkinan sukses paling besar.

Page 21: KECERDASAN BUATAN

Inferensi (Penarikan Kesimpulan) AI mencoba membuat mesin memiliki kemampuan berpikir atau mempertimbangkan (reasoning), termasuk didalamnya proses (inferencing) berdasarkan fakta-fakta dan aturan dengan menggunakan metode heuristik, dll

Pencocokan Pola (Pattern Matching) Berusaha untuk menjelaskan obyek, kejadian (events) atau proses, dalam hubungan logik atau komputasional

Page 22: KECERDASAN BUATAN

Tujuan Kecerdasan Buatan Membuat komputer lebih cerdas Mengerti tentang kecerdasan Membuat mesin lebih berguna

Page 23: KECERDASAN BUATAN

Perbedaan Kecerdasan Buatan dengan Kecerdasan Alami

Lebih permanen Menawarkan kemudahan duplikasi dan

penyebaran Lebih murah daripada kecerdasan alami Konsisten dan menyeluruh Dapat didokumentasikan Dapat mengeksekusi tugas tertentu lebih cepat

daripada manusia Dapat menjalankan tugas tertentu lebih baik dari

banyak atau kebanyakan orang.

Page 24: KECERDASAN BUATAN

Kelebihan Kecerdasan Alami Dibanding Kecerdasan Buatan Bersifat lebih kreatif

Dapat melakukan proses pembelajaran secara langsung, sementara AI harus mendapatkan masukan berupa simbol dan representasi-representasi

Menggunakan fokus yang luas sebagai referensi untuk pengambilan keputusan. Sebaliknya, AI menggunakan fokus yang sempit

Page 25: KECERDASAN BUATAN

Perbedaan Antara Pemrograman AI dan Konvensional

Page 26: KECERDASAN BUATAN

Domain Yang Sering DibahasMundane Task

- Persepsi (vision & speech)

- Bahasa alami (understanding, generation &

translation)

- Pemikiran yang bersifat commonsense

- Robot control

Formal Task

- Permainan / Games

- Matematika (Geometri, logika, kalkulus integral,

pembuktian)

Page 27: KECERDASAN BUATAN

Expert Task

- Analisis finansial

- Analisis medikal

- Analisis ilmu pengetahuan

- Rekayasa (design, pencarian kegagalan,

perencanaan manufaktur)

Page 28: KECERDASAN BUATAN

Kecerdasan Buatan Saat Ini Berbagai produk AI berhasil dibangun dan digunakan

dalam kehidupan sehari-hari. Produk-produk tersebut dikelompokkan ke dalam

empat teknik yang ada di AI, yaitu : searching, reasoning, planning dan learning.

Contoh-contohnya :o GPS (Rute Optimal)o Caturo MedicWare (Rekam medis Pasien)o Speech Processing (Pengenalan suara, Pengenalan

Pembicara)o Computer Visiono Robotic

Page 29: KECERDASAN BUATAN

Kecerdasan Buatan Masa Depan Tahun 2019, sebuah Pc seharga $1000 akan

setara dengan kemampuan komputasional otak manusia.o Virtual Realityo Interaksi komputer dengan isyarat tubuh

Tahun 2029, sebuah PC $1000 akan setara dengan kemampuan komputasional seribu otak manusia.o Komputer dapat terhubung dengan otak manusiao Komputer mampu membaca semua literatur dan

material multimedia.

Page 30: KECERDASAN BUATAN

Tahun 2049, makanan diproduksi menggunakan nano technology.

Tahun 2072, picoengineering atau tenologi pada skala picometer atau 10-12 meter berhasil diaplikasikan.

Tahun 2099, ada kecenderungan untuk membuat gabungan antara pemikiran manusia dan kecerdasan mesin. Sehingga kita tidak dapat membedakan lagi apakah agent tersebut adalah mesin atau manusia.

Page 31: KECERDASAN BUATAN

SEKIAN DAN TERIMA KASIH